(NASDAQ: KMDA; TASE: KMDA.TA), a global biopharmaceutical company with a portfolio of marketed products indicated for rare and serious conditions and a leader in the specialty plasma-derived field, today announced that, based on its positive outlook for 2026, it is forecasting continued double-digit profitable growth with 2026 annual guidance of $200 million - $205 million in revenues and $50 million - $53 million of adjusted EBITDA. Importantly, the projected 2026 growth is based solely on continued organic growth of the Company’s diverse commercial products portfolio in multiple markets in both its Proprietary segment which covers the specialty plasma therapies and the Distribution segment which covers commercialization of in-licensing third parties biopharmaceutical products. The 2026 midpoint guidance range represents a year-over-year increase of 13% in revenues and 23% in adjusted EBITDA, based on the mid-points of Kamada’s 2025 guidance. The Company further announced that it expects to achieve its 2025 financial guidance of $178 million - $182 million in revenues and $40 million - $44 million of adjusted EBITDA, with 2025 year-end cash of approximately $75 million. Kamada intends to publish its 2025 financial results during the first half of March 2026. “We enter 2026 from a position of significant commercial and financial strength and are excited about the progress we have made over the past year,” said Amir London, Kamada’s Chief Executive Officer. “We look forward to achieving our value generating objectives for 2026, driven by continued organic growth of our diverse commercial product portfolio marketed in over 30 countries.
